Siddhartha Shankar Ray Politician

Siddhartha Shankar Ray (Bengali: সিদ্ধার্থশঙ্কর রায়) (20 October 1920 – 6 November 2010) was a Bengali politician belonging to the Indian National Congress. He was a prominent barrister, Punjab Governor and Education minister of India. He was also the ambassador of India to the United States of America and served as the Chief Minister of West Bengal from 1972 to 1977.
